Responsibilities & Qualifications

RESPONSIBILITIES

The NMCC High Altitude Electromagnetic Pulse CCC Technician
position is responsible for the following:

  • Perform engineering for new circuit installations modifications and deactivations.
  • Provide technical and operational support to end-user services network expansions and modernization of telecommunications backbone systems.
  • Provide problem resolution for all hardware and software elements of the data communication circuits maintained by the work center to include Commercial and GFE owned networks.
  • Provide outage and restoration information as required to include restore times.
  • Ensure the availability of the circuits in coordination with other work centers as required.
  • Perform status updates and circuit monitoring as needed.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S

  • Active TS/SCI clearance.
  • Active DoD 8570 IAT II certification (ex. Security).
  • No degree 6 years relevant and progressive experience;
    Bachelors degree 2 years relevant experience;
    Masters degree 0 years of experience.
  • Successful completion of technical training associated with operations and maintenance of a Tech Control Facility equivalent to that required for US military AFSC 3C2X1 MOS 31P or EC2318.
  • Communications-Computer Systems Control Technician or the equivalent civilian training and work experience in a similar civilian or military systems control facility.
    • Successful completion of military/civilian communications electrons courses such as Radio Relay Maintenance Computer Switching Systems Maintenance and Cryptographic Maintenance along with operation experience associated with technical control or patch and test facility will be considered in lieu of formal technical controller training.
  • Strong background and working knowledge of the DISA Operational Circulars.
  • Background in maintenance of TCF equipment and excellent understanding of digital and analog test equipment. multiplexers modems circuit maintenance equipment and systems records files and diagrams.
  • Familiar with various encryption devices e.g. KG-84 KIV-7 KG-194 KG-95 KG-94 etc including device substitution. key and re-keying.

Overview

We are seeking a NMCC High Altitude Electromagnetic Pulse CCC Technician to support the Continuous Cyber Security posture within the National Military Command Center in Arlington VA (Pentagon). The AFNCR IT Services program provides support services for information systems for Headquarters Air Force (HAF) Air Force District of Washington (AFDW) Office of the Secretary of Defense (OSD) Joint Chiefs of Staff and other Air Force activities within the AFNCR missions to include the Pentagon Joint Base Andrews (JBA) Joint Base Anacostia-Bolling (JBAB) and other locations leased spaces and alternate sites.
